🎉 chunkflow - Effortless Uploads for Large Files

🚀 Getting Started
chunkflow is a simple tool for uploading large files quickly and easily. It supports chunked uploads, resumable uploads for interrupted connections, and instant uploading. This means you can upload files without stress, knowing that your progress will be saved if anything goes wrong.

đź“„ User Guide
To help you understand how to use chunkflow, here are the main steps involved in uploading a file:
- Select Your File:
- Click on the “Select File” button.
- Choose the file you wish to upload from your computer.
- Start Uploading:
- After selecting the file, click on the “Upload” button.
- You will see a progress bar indicating the upload status.
- Resuming Uploads:
- If your upload is interrupted, chunkflow will automatically save your current progress.
- Simply restart chunkflow, select the same file, and click “Resume Upload.”
- Instant Upload:
- For smaller files, use the “Instant Upload” option for a quicker process.
- This will send files directly without chunking them.
📊 Features
chunkflow comes with several features that make it a robust solution for handling large file uploads:
- Chunked Upload: Breaks your file into smaller pieces to ensure a smooth upload process.
- Resumable Upload: Automatically saves progress, allowing you to continue uploads after interruptions.
- Cross-Platform Support: Works seamlessly on Windows, macOS, and Linux.
- Instant Upload Capability: Quickly upload smaller files without any delays.
đź”§ Troubleshooting
Here are some common issues and their solutions:
- Slow Upload Speeds:
- Check your Internet connection to ensure it is stable.
- Try uploading during off-peak hours for better speeds.
- Upload Interruptions:
- If your upload stops, simply restart chunkflow and click “Resume Upload.”
- File Size Limits:
- Ensure the file size does not exceed any limits set by your service provider or network.
âť“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What types of files can I upload?
A: You can upload any file type, whether it’s documents, images, or videos, as long as the total size is within your service limits.
Q: Is chunkflow free to use?
A: Yes, chunkflow is completely free for everyone.
Q: Can I upload more than one file at a time?
A: Yes, you can select multiple files to queue for upload, but only one will upload at a time.
